Oxycodone, also known as OxyContin or simply “Oxy” is a very powerful opioid painkiller that’s used for extended relief of pain. While considered a miracle drug by many chronic pain sufferers, the abuse of oxycodone has grown wildly in the state of Georgia. Misuse of Oxycodone can lead to dependence.  An addiction to oxycodone can cause incredible damage to the lives of those who abuse it. Oxycodone misuse can lead to relationship conflict, job loss, and financial disaster. More importantly, oxycodone abuse can lead to slowed breathing, lowered blood oxygen, and even death. Detoxification Treatment

Residential Sub-acute Detoxification Treatment

In some cases, individuals who have been experiencing an addiction to OxyCodone struggle with also being physically dependent on the painkiller. For those who meet this description, and who have had great difficulty ending the OxyCodone abuse prior to entering rehab at Blue Ridge Mountain Recovery Center, we provide medically monitored detoxification services to ease the process.

Blue Ridge is one of the few treatment centers in Georgia offering a full range of clinical and sub-acute medical services, including medically supervised detox, and is staffed 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. Our detoxification treatment begins with a complete evaluation of the client’s OxyContin abuse history, current characteristics, and patterns of use. In this phase of rehab, each individual is supervised by our medical director and nursing staff to ensure safe detoxification and a more comfortable withdrawal process. Once an individual has completed detox with us, he or she can then transition directly into residential treatment.

Residential Oxycodone Rehab Center

Clinically Managed Residential Oxycodone Rehab Center

Blue Ridge Mountain Recovery Center offers residential treatment that keeps recovery simple, yet logical. Rehab at our treatment center includes individual therapy, group therapy, activities designed to heighten wellness, and medical management of symptoms (as needed).

Individual Therapy: We offer a number of treatment techniques in individual therapy, including psycho-social education, cognitive-behavioral therapy, dialectical behavior therapy, music therapy, relapse prevention, relapse recovery and multiple family therapy models. Individual sessions between a client who is seeking rehabilitation for OxyCodone addiction and a trained professional can provide valuable opportunities for the client to process successes and setbacks, address specific issues related to his or her recovery, and receive essential guidance and feedback.

Group Therapy: At our treatment center, we implement groups based on three learning styles; cognitive (intellectual learning), effective (emotional learning) and skills development (“how to” learning). Our rehab is designed to engage the spiritual, emotional, mental, physical, social, legal and vocational needs of our clients helping them transform their whole person.

Medical Management of Symptoms: For those seeking OxyCodone addiction treatment at our center who are also suffering from co-occurring issues, medical management of mental health symptoms may be provided as needed. If our initial medical evaluation indicates that a client may benefit from medications, he or she may receive medication management services from our psychiatrists and certified registered nurse practitioners.

Family Therapy: During the rehab process at our treatment center, we believe it is vital to provide education and guidance to the family and loved ones of our clients who struggle with OxyCodone addiction. Our family program is provided, at no additional cost, to immediate family members and loved ones of clients at our residential treatment center. Approximately every three weeks, we offer family and loved ones the opportunity to participate in our two-day long family workshop. This experience seeks to include family members and loved ones in the treatment process and provides the opportunity for family to learn more about addiction and recovery. We also provide family sessions throughout each client’s stay at our center as deemed appropriate by their therapist.
